The Spring Into Action event saw a decent turnout despite the cooler temperatures.

Clouds, rain and wind were all a factor during the Spring Into Action Event which was done on The Rose Trail in Rosetown. This is an event in which promotes a healthy lifestyle by staying fit, and getting out of the house for exercise.

This event is opened to all people of all ages, and is simply just a fun-free event. There was a 2 kilometre event as well as a 5 kilometre event to choose from.

Many people ran in separate groups with the competitive runners going together, and then the amateur runners going at their own pace. Everyone was striving to do their very best, and finish the marathon in the quickest amount of time possible.

Money was not a factor to enter this marathon, because the organizers weren't looking for money. Simply just promoting a healthy lifestyle, and being active within the community can go a long ways to a happy lifestyle.

Organizers gave away entry prizes as well as participation prizes to all of those that gave the marathon a chance.
